.wpcf7-form label{display:block;font-size:18px;font-weight:700;margin-bottom:5px}.wpcf7-form input[type=text],.wpcf7-form input[type=email],.wpcf7-form input[type=tel],.wpcf7-form textarea{width:100%;padding:10px;margin-bottom:10px;border:1px solid #ccc;border-radius:4px;font-size:16px}.wpcf7-form input[type=submit]{background-color:#00aeef;color:#fff;padding:10px 20px;border:none;border-radius:4px;font-size:18px;cursor:pointer;display:block;margin:0 auto}.wpcf7-form input[type=submit]:hover{background-color:#007b9e}.unique-form-class .custom-form-wrapper{display:flex;justify-content:center;align-items:center;height:100vh;background-color:#f8f9fa}.unique-form-class .elementor-container{max-width:600px;width:100%;padding:20px;background:#fff;box-shadow:0 4px 8px rgba(0,0,0,.1);border-radius:8px}.unique-form-class .elementor-container form{display:flex;flex-direction:column}.unique-form-class .elementor-container form label{margin-bottom:10px;font-weight:700}.unique-form-class .elementor-container form input,.unique-form-class .elementor-container form select{margin-bottom:20px;padding:10px;border:1px solid #ccc;border-radius:4px;width:100%}.unique-form-class .elementor-container form .wpcf7-submit{align-self:center;padding:10px 20px;border:none;background-color:#0af;color:white;border-radius:4px;cursor:pointer}.unique-form-class .elementor-container form .wpcf7-submit:hover{background-color:#007acc}.item-footer.clearfix{display:none}